Tsunoda Bortoleto Miss Out in Chaotic COTA Sprint Qualifying

The first part of the sprint qualifying at the Circuit of the Americas was chaotic. Six drivers failed to complete their fast lap in time and therefore did not advance to SQ2. Among them were Yuki Tsunoda and Gabriel Bortoleto, but both Haas drivers were also eliminated prematurely.

The problems began in the final seconds of SQ1, where the entire field was preparing for a final fast lap. As often happens, they waited until the track conditions were optimal – but this time the game of ‘who leaves last’ proved fatal. A bottleneck in the final corner meant that several drivers crossed the start/finish line only after the flag was waved, and therefore their lap could not be counted.
